What Does “Prise OBD” Even Mean?

Let’s break it down. “Prise” is French for “socket” or “connector”, and “OBD” stands for On-Board Diagnostics. So, “prise OBD” simply translates to “OBD port” – that familiar rectangular connector found in most cars, usually located under the dashboard on the driver’s side. It’s the portal to your car’s computer, allowing mechanics and DIY enthusiasts to diagnose issues and access valuable data.

Tesla and the OBD Port: A Tale of Two Systems

Imagine this: you’re a mechanic used to the trusty OBD port, ready to plug in your scanner. You slide under the dash of a Tesla, and…nothing. No familiar port. Instead, you find a universe of data accessible through the car’s central computer system and, increasingly, over-the-air diagnostics.

This divergence from the norm has led to some confusion, with many searching for a traditional “prise OBD” on their Teslas. The truth is, while Teslas don’t have a standard OBD-II port like most gasoline-powered vehicles, they do have diagnostic ports. They’re just not located in the usual spot and require specialized adapters and software to access.

FAQs: Your “Prise OBD” Questions Answered

Q: Can I use a regular OBD-II scanner on my Tesla?

A: Not directly. You’ll need a Tesla-specific adapter and compatible software.

Q: Where can I find information about my Tesla’s diagnostics?

A: Your Tesla’s owner’s manual and Tesla’s official website are excellent resources.

Q: Are there any risks associated with using third-party diagnostic tools?

A: It’s crucial to choose reputable brands and consult with experienced technicians to avoid potential damage to your car’s system.
